我认为,编码规范,在软件构件以及项目管理中,甚至是个人成长方面,都发挥着重要的作用,好的编码规范是提高我们代码质量的最有效的工具之一。 几乎每个项目,每家公司都会定义自己的编码规范,我们可以参考一下华为公司C/C++的编码规范。 1、代码排版 1、程序块要采用缩进风格编写,缩进的空格数为4个(说明:对于由开发工具...
1 排版 2 注释 3 标识符命名 4 可读性 5 变量、 结构 6 函数、 过程 7 可测性 8 程序效率 9 质量保证 10 代码编辑、 编译、 审查 11 代码测试、 维护 12 宏 61118202228364044505253
1、2022年6月26日星期日1课程名称:课程名称:软件工程软件工程任课教师:任课教师:郭雷勇郭雷勇E-mail: 第第5章章 软件编码软件编码华为软件编程规范和范例华为软件编程规范和范例2022年6月26日星期日2华为软件编程规范和范例-一=排版 =. 二=注释=. 三=标识符命名=. 四=可读性=. 五=变量、结构=. 六=函数...
编码规范(华为)
1本规范为华为技术有限公司自己制定的规范,这些规范授权部门可以修改;本规范引用了华为技术有限公司计划财经部制定的《华为技术有限公司产品分类编码标准》。 四、资料版本编码信息结构 图1资料版本编码信息结构 五、资料版本编码信息结构描述 资料版本编码信息包括出版部门信息、产品类、出版年月日、资料编号、密级、资料升...
昨天在我建立的粉丝4群中看到有小伙伴分享一份C/C++编程规范,疑似华为编程规范,很多人都觉得不错,今天来分享一下。对了,如果你也是一名互联网从业者,欢迎加入我组建的社群一起交流,群里有大牛也有小白。 欢迎你添加我的微信,我拉你进技术交流群。此外,我也会经常在微信上分享一些计算机学习经验以及工作体验,还有...
采用这种松散方式编写代码目的是让程序更加清晰由于空格所产生的清晰性是相对的所以在已经很清晰的语句中没有必要留空格如果语句已足够清晰则括号内侧即左括号后面和右括号前面不需要加空格多重括号间不必加空格因为java中括号已经是很清晰的标志了 华为JAVA编码规范介绍...
v1.0可编写可更正Documentnumber文档编号Confidentialitylevel密级内部公开Documentversion文档版本Total26pages共26页Java语言编码规范PreparedbyDateyyyymmd
1 如果输入源和输出目标直接支持,尽可能直接使用unicode进行输入输出。对 2 方法尽量通过方法签名自注释,按需写方法头注释。对 3 为了提升性能,可以不加控制的创建新线...
华为编码规范.pdf,软件编程规范总则 软件编程规范总则 1 1 排版 8 1- 1:程序块要采用缩进风格编写,缩进的空格数为4 个。 8 1- 2:相对独立的程序块之间、变量说明之后必须加空行。 8 1- 3:较长的语句(80 字符)要分成多行书写,长表达式要在低优先级操作符处划分新行,